which type of cell respiration produces the most atp? aerobic respiration anaerobic respiration both produce the same amount
Aerobic respiration occurs in the presence of oxygen and goes through glycolysis, the Krebs cycle, and the electron transport chain. The electron transport chain in aerobic respiration generates a large amount of ATP. Anaerobic respiration (like fermentation) occurs without oxygen. It only goes through glycolysis (which produces a small amount of ATP) and then a fermentation step that does not produce additional ATP. So aerobic respiration produces more ATP.
